Abstract

A through the hole rotary position sensor which incorporates a single ring magnet with a central aperture. The rotating shaft whose angular position is to be sensed is received in the central aperture. The through the hole rotary position sensor includes a pair of pole pieces which extend around the circular magnet. Magnetic flux responsive elements are disposed adjacent the pole pieces. In order to shield the sensor from undesirable magnetic flux influences through the rotatable shaft, an internal shunt ring is provided around the exterior of the rotatable shaft. The circular magnet, pole pieces, magnetic flux responsive element, optional shunt rings and shunt discs are carried by a non-magnetic housing.
